Eagles miss 1 point on the miss.
Second TD Pederson goes for 2 (due to the first miss) and misses that making lost points total 2
Last TD they go for 2 again (due to earlier missed points) and fail again bringing missed points to 3
Bottom line the missed extra point led to the Eagles having 3 less points.

I know it didn't matter I'm just sayin

That is correct, but his point was due to the first missed XP, and then Pederson making a bad decision to chase the missed XP, they had lost 2 points. Had Pederson not chased on the second TD he would not have had to go for 2 near the end to try and go up from 38-33 to 40-33 because it would have already been 39-33 and the XP would have made it a 7 point lead.

The XP miss was unfortunate and unexpected. Although it ended up not making a difference, chasing the XP point miss with a 2 point conversion try early in the game was not smart. And yes, I would say it was not smart whether they converted it or not. It was too early to chase.
